Summary: Cr.A(SJ) /359/2019 - Antu Rajwar v. State of Jharkhand The Jharkhand High Court allowed Antu Rajwar's appeal and quashed his conviction under Section 307 IPC (attempted murder) for allegedly assaulting two persons with a weapon. The court found the prosecution evidence riddled with contradictions: eye witnesses gave conflicting accounts about how many people were present; no forensic examination confirmed the weapon; and a counter-case for molestation existed against the prosecution witnesses, suggesting potential bias and fabrication.
